Transaction 668d009885c2b8a27ab597ec229d33dee2800b3e27183afb5ababb1c65bf8374

1 Input
2 Outputs
  • 668d009885c2b8a27ab597ec229d33dee2800b3e27183afb5ababb1c65bf8374:0
  • value  1000000
    address  13mA82c5VqYAt8QfFMoMJBLh5RCB3fQgvf
  • 668d009885c2b8a27ab597ec229d33dee2800b3e27183afb5ababb1c65bf8374:1
  • value  28350700
    address  1FoUK3FMaPQbGQ8Z7sHCGvJxyPqocrQ1R2